Clare star John Conlon is understood to have damaged his cruciate ligament injury in training last Tuesday.

Clonlara man Conlon suffered an injury-hit 2019 season having played the 2018 All-Ireland semi-final replay against Galway with a partially torn posterior cruciate ligament. Against Wexford 13 months ago, he ruptured ankle ligaments.
Already this year Limerick defender Richie English and last year’s young hurler of the year Adrian Mullen of Kilkenny have been ruled out
for the season with cruciate setbacks.
